Presenting the fifth budget of the AAP government for 2026–27, proposing a total outlay of Rs 2,60,437 crore and projecting the Gross State Domestic Product (GSDP) at Rs 9,80,635 crore with an estimated growth rate of 10%, the finance minister Harpal Cheema tabled the said scheme that also marked the International Women’s Day and was being seen as a major budget move ahead of polls.
